Within a calculation group, I'm attempting to set up two PriorDay variables that work with selectedmeasure()... The first would be the maxx calendar date less 1 day, and the other maxx calendar date less 364 days.
The below DAX for 1 day returns the expected result, but when swapping 1 for 364 I do not. — I've tried different combinations of DATEADD and MIN MAX but no luck
I'm sure it's user error. Hoping someone here can help. Thanks!
VAR vToday = MAXX('Calendar','Calendar'[Date])
VAR vPriorDay = MAXX('Calendar','Calendar'[Date]) - 1
VAR MeasureToday = CALCULATE(Selectedmeasure(),FILTER('Calendar','Calendar'[Date] = vToday))
VAR MeasurePriorDay = CALCULATE(Selectedmeasure(),FILTER('Calendar','Calendar'[Date] = vPriorDay))
RETURN
MeasureToday - MeasurePriorDay
Solved! Go to Solution.
@1Kash_PBI , I case some dates are selected and you want fo beyond those dates, use all
VAR MeasurePriorDay = CALCULATE(Selectedmeasure(),FILTER(all('Calendar'),'Calendar'[Date] = vPriorDay))
